Petroecuador Emissions Test Summary

Petroecuador is the national oil company of the country of Ecuador. In October of 2003 Green plus was tested over a period of 30 days. The test was done to show the effectiveness of Green Plus in two scenarios, in stationary diesel engines and in diesel buses. The stationary engine test was performed on three Bazan Man pump engines, used to pump fuel throughout Ecuador, and on two Chevrolet (Botar) Buses. The results of the stationary test (as shown in the graphs below) show that NOx was reduced by an average of 48.51%, Carbon Monoxide by 51.2%, and Sulfur Dioxide by 51.84%. The results of the bus tests show a reduction in NOx of 53.3%, in Carbon Monoxide of 51.2% and in Sulfur Dioxide of 21.3%.
